In other #ThingUmbrella related news: I've completed the weekend round — 65+ commits — of restructuring & splitting up some larger packages, with the result of there being nine more of them now. 198 in total! Another side effect of this effort is generally fewer dependencies, incl. for some select other core packages (partially by choosing to intern small functions/functionality, in cases where it made sense...)

The new packages (but existing functionality!) are:

- thi.ng/bidir-index : Bi-directional map/index data structure
- thi.ng/disjoint-set: Disjoint Set data structure w/ path compression (useful for union-find tasks)
- thi.ng/object-utils : Plain JS object & map manipulation
- thi.ng/pixel-convolve: Extensible image convolution, preset kernels, normal map generation
- thi.ng/pixel-dominant-colors: k-means based dominant color extraction from images
- thi.ng/sorted-map: Skiplist-based sorted map & set data structures
- thi.ng/sparse-set : Sparse set data structure
- thi.ng/trie : Trie-based map data structure w/ prefix search/query
- thi.ng/uuid : Binary & string-based UUID v4 generation

The packages which have been split up have received major version updates w/ notices on both readmes & changelogs:
